In 1909, Kathleen Chase Taylor entered the world in Stromsburg, Polk, Ne, born to Edwin Thomas Taylor And Almeda Meda Emily Chase. Kathleen Chase Taylor married Raymond Walker. Kathleen Chase Taylor passed away in 1979 in Washington, Oregon, United States.
